This is a truly adorable button of Chrysocolla coated Malachite from the Star of the Congo Mine in the DRC. This mine has produced an incredible diversity of beautiful copper-bearing minerals and this thumbnail is in the top category of specimens from there. The button is blue-green with a satin luster, measures 1.8cm in diameter and is situated on just a dab of matrix that complements the button so well! The periphery of the matrix and a small opening into the piece on one side reveals a layer of green Malachite with a radial fibrous structure with the interior of the ball also composed of Malachite. The story here is that the Chrysocolla formed later in the history of the piece and coated the Malachite ball and whatever Malachite matrix was present. An absolutely gorgeous thumbnail with a great paragenesis!
